fakeimagedetection / config.json
kampkelly's picture
Update config.json
0e7e341
{
"architectures": [
"EfficientNetB0"
],
"model_type": "EfficientNetB0",
"num_labels": 7,
"hidden_size": 300,
"num_attention_heads": 1,
"num_hidden_layers": 2,
"intermediate_size": 1200,
"hidden_act": "relu",
"hidden_dropout_prob": 0.2,
"attention_probs_dropout_prob": 0.2,
"initializer_range": 0.02,
"layer_norm_eps": 1e-12,
"image_size": 128,
"num_channels": 3,
"rescale": 0.00392156863,
"shear_range": 0.2,
"zoom_range": 0.2,
"horizontal_flip": true,
"batch_size": 64,
"learning_rate": 0.001,
"loss": "categorical_crossentropy",
"metrics": ["accuracy"],
"callbacks": [
{
"type": "EarlyStopping",
"params": {
"monitor": "val_loss",
"mode": "min",
"patience": 5,
"verbose": 1
}
},
{
"type": "ModelCheckpoint",
"params": {
"filepath": "./best_model_EB0_7_classification.h5",
"monitor": "val_loss",
"mode": "min",
"verbose": 1,
"save_best_only": true
}
}
],
"label2id": {
"celeba": 0,
"celeba_hq": 1,
"deepfakes": 2,
"face2face": 3,
"faceswap": 4,
"neuraltextures": 5,
"youtube": 6
},
"id2label": {
"0": "celeba",
"1": "celeba_hq",
"2": "deepfakes",
"3": "face2face",
"4": "faceswap",
"5": "neuraltextures",
"6": "youtube"
}
}